"This is a refreshing Cuban drink. It's hard to stop drinking these on a hot summers day. I made these for the fourth of July and we went on to 3 yes 3 pitchers! If you don't have a muddle stick try a mortar and pestle or the end of a wooden rolling pin. Please use fresh lime if you cannot go ahead and try the already bottled lime juice but if you do think about that when you rate this recipe! I did both and there's nothing like fresh! Same goes for the fresh mint if you need to you can use frozen but I DON'T recommend extract. And for the sugar real granular is what helps muddles the lime and extract the mint oils from the leaves."

ingredients

  • 10 limes, fresh pulp and juice
  • 30 leaves of fresh mint
  • 34 cup sugar
  • 1 cup white rum
  • club soda, chilled

Advertisem*nt

directions

  • Place lime juice, mint and sugar into a pitcher.
  • Using a muddle stick mash to release mint oils, and dissolve sugar into juice.
  • Add rum and lots of ice topped with club soda. Adding more club soda to glasses if a lighter drink is desired.
  • Garnish with fresh mint and lime slices.
